How Our Residential Water Extraction Service Works in New Port Richey, FL

Our team’s process for water extraction involves several key steps to ensure that your home is thoroughly dried and restored. We’ll use specialized equipment to remove standing water and then use dehumidifiers to dry out the affected area. This process can take anywhere from 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age. Our goal is to get your home back to normal as quickly as possible while also ensuring that the job is done right.

Step 1: Assessment and Containment

Our team will arrive on site quickly to assess the damage and contain the affected area to prevent further dam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to remove standing water and any visible debris.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Our expert technicians will extract water using specialized pumps and equipment to remove as much water as possible from the affected area.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use dehumidifiers to dry out the affected area and prevent further moisture buildup.

Step 4: Final Inspection and Cleaning

Our team will inspect the area to ensure that it’s dry and safe for you to return to.

Step 5: Restoration and Repair

We’ll work with you to create a plan for any necessary repairs or reconstruction.

Residential Water Extraction Cost in New Port Richey, FL

The cost of residential water extraction in New Port Richey, FL can vary dep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 The severity of the damage and the size of the affected area can affect the cost of water extraction.
Drying and Dehumidification $300 – $1,500 The size of the affected area and the type of equipment used can affect the cost of drying and dehumidification.
Final Inspection and Cleaning $200 – $1,000 The size of the affected area and the type of equipment used can affect the cost of final inspection and cleaning.
Restoration and Repair $1,000 – $5,000 The severity of the damage and the size of the affected area can affect the cost of restoration and repair.
Containment and Equipment Rental $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the type of equipment used can affect the cost of containment and equipment rental.

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and may vary depending on your specific situation. We offer free estimates and will work with you to create a personalized plan that fits your needs and budget.
